The old vine fruit in this wine (70% of which was planted in 1959) provides an intense, complex, richly flavored wine.



Pale, creamy yellow.


Ripe aromas of grapefruit and passion fruit with a touch of grass and flinty characteristics.

Item:
Sauvignon Blanc

Grape Variety/Varieties:
100% Estate Grown Sauvignon Blanc

Age of Vines:
16 - 24 years

Alcohol Level:
14.1%

Acid Level:
.65 g/100 ml

pH Level:
3.25

Sugar Level:
Dry

Dates Grapes Picked:
August 30, September 8 - 10, 2001

Length/Type of Fermentation:
30% barrel fermentation for 12 days and 70% tank fermentation for 25 days

Fermentation Temperature:
Barrel: 70°F; Tank: 60°F

Length/Type of Aging:
French Oak (30%, 17% New) for 5 months

Date Wine was Bottled:
February 2001

Number of cases:
3,053
